Introduction
Departmental majors can earn either the B.A. or the B.S. degree by meeting the general university requirements and the general requirements of the School of Engineering (see Requirements for a Bachelor's Degree, including Writing Requirement, in this catalogue) departmental requirements.
The Department of Applied Mathematics and Statistics awards departmental honours based on several factors, including performance in coursework and research experience. To be eligible for departmental honours, a student must:
achieve a 3.75 GPA in AMS Department courses (EN.553) used toward major requirements 1-11, and earn a C- or better in an additional one-semester course in AMS (EN.553) at the 300-level or higher, or undertake significant research activity (equivalent to a 3-credit course) in a subject related to applied mathematics. Such research can be conducted as an official research course. The student may request that the research supervisor provide an assessment to AMS academic staff toward the middle of the semester of the intended degree conferral.
